Responsibilities
- Check daily production schedules and follow Sodexo recipes to prepare a variety of baked items from scratch, such as breads, rolls, muffins, biscuits, cakes, and pastries.
- Accurately weigh and measure ingredients, mix doughs and batters by hand or mixer, shape and cut dough, and bake items to perfection.
- Regulate oven temperatures, monitor baking times, and ensure all products are prepared, held, and served at correct temperatures.
- Set up and stock the bake shop area, maintain proper storage, rotation, labeling, and dating of all products, and keep the bakery clean and organized.
- Pay close attention to detail, accommodate special requests, and ensure only high-quality baked items leave the kitchen.
